About this book
In Political Dynamics of Grassroots Democracy in Vietnam, Hai Hong Nguyen investigates the correlation between independent variables and grassroots democracy to demonstrate that grassroots democracy has created a mutually empowering mechanism for both the party-state and the peasantry.

About the author
Hai Hong Nguyen is a Research Fellow at the University of Queensland, Australia. He holds a Masters in International Human Rights and Humanitarian Law from Lund University, Sweden, and a PhD in Political Science from the University of Queensland, Australia. He has been teaching international human rights law, international relations, and politics in Vietnam and Australia.
